* clk: tegra: Fix clock rate computationThierry Reding2013-11-261-0/+2
| | | | | | | | | | The PLL output frequency is multiplied during the P-divider computation, so it needs to be divided by the P-divider again before returning. This fixes an issue where clk_round_rate() would return the multiplied frequency instead of the real one after the P-divider. Signed-off-by: Thierry Reding <treding@nvidia.com>

| * clk: tegra30: Don't wait for PLL_U lock bitTuomas Tynkkynen2013-08-281-1/+1
| | | | | | | | | | | | | | | | | | | | | | The lock bit on PLL_U does not seem to be working correctly and sometimes never gets set when waiting for the PLL to come up. Remove the TEGRA_PLL_USE_LOCK flag to use a constant delay. | * clk: tegra: T114: add DFLL DVCO reset controlPaul Walmsley2013-06-182-0/+39
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Add DFLL DVCO reset line control functions to the CAR IP block driver. The DVCO present in the DFLL IP block has a separate reset line, exposed via the CAR IP block. This reset line is asserted upon SoC reset. Unless something (such as the DFLL driver) deasserts this line, the DVCO will not oscillate, although reads and writes to the DFLL IP block will complete.
